Output 190d2c569bde084d0d9198ea7fe83d18eb2b8fc8695f3c1afb817a712154a116:88

value
107968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5ef14551d938999cb8cd29efa28f6b37272dd8 OP_EQUAL
address
34Tbw1vURuTXvWFsoWFPUMk7FbEzpnmy7h
transaction
190d2c569bde084d0d9198ea7fe83d18eb2b8fc8695f3c1afb817a712154a116
confirmations
205061
spent
true